2015 GS-6 pay table for INDIANAPOLIS
Each step below already includes the 14.68% locality adjustment. The "Locality add-on" column shows how much locality pay is adding compared with the base GS-6 table.
| Step | Annual salary | Biweekly pay | Hourly rate | Locality add-on |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Step 1 | $35,771 | $1,375.81 | $17.14 | +$4,579 |
| Step 2 | $36,964 | $1,421.69 | $17.71 | +$4,732 |
| Step 3 | $38,156 | $1,467.54 | $18.28 | +$4,884 |
| Step 4 | $39,349 | $1,513.42 | $18.85 | +$5,037 |
| Step 5 | $40,542 | $1,559.31 | $19.43 | +$5,190 |
| Step 6 | $41,734 | $1,605.15 | $20.00 | +$5,342 |
| Step 7 | $42,927 | $1,651.04 | $20.57 | +$5,495 |
| Step 8 | $44,120 | $1,696.92 | $21.14 | +$5,648 |
| Step 9 | $45,312 | $1,742.77 | $21.71 | +$5,800 |
| Step 10 | $46,505 | $1,788.65 | $22.28 | +$5,953 |

GS-6 in INDIANAPOLIS: what to expect
Experienced technicians and mid-level administrative support, including contract specialists, paralegals, medical technicians and HR specialists.
For 2015, the INDIANAPOLIS pay area adds a 14.68% locality adjustment on top of the nationwide base GS schedule. Every GS-6 employee assigned to this area benefits from that same percentage, regardless of step or series.
Qualifications and career path
Minimum qualifications. One year of specialized experience at the GS-5 level, or a master's degree for some series.
Promotion path. Promoted to GS-7 after one year of creditable experience in the grade.

Biweekly take-home for GS-6 in INDIANAPOLIS
Before taxes and deductions, a GS-6 Step 1 employee in INDIANAPOLIS earns roughly $1,376 per biweekly pay period. At Step 10 that rises to $1,789. Actual take-home will be lower after federal tax, state tax, TSP contributions, retirement and health insurance deductions.
